OverviewAt KPMG, you’ll join a team of diverse and dedicated problem solvers, connected by a common cause turning insight into opportunity for clients and communities around the world.What You Will DoBuild and integrate generative AI capabilities and agentic solutions such as AI agents using Copilot Studio, Microsoft Power Platform, and related toolsDevelop and maintain custom connectors, APIs, and AI integrations with enterprise systems including ServiceNOW and Moveworks Agent StudioDesign, develop, and deploy solutions using Microsoft Power Platform (Power Apps, Power Automate, AI Builder)Collaborate with business stakeholders to gather, interpret, and translate requirements into intelligent automation solutionsSupport the full lifecycle of solution delivery from ideation and prototyping to deployment and maintenanceEnsure solutions are secure, scalable, and aligned with enterprise architecture standardsWhat You Bring To The RoleComputer Science degree or equivalent educationStrong interpersonal and communication skills with the ability to engage business users and technical teams alikeA passion for AI innovation and a strong understanding of how to apply generative AI to real-world business challengesAbility to manage multiple priorities and deliver high-quality results in a fast-paced environmentExperience working in cross-functional teams and agile development environmentsComfort with ambiguity and a willingness to take initiative and ownership of outcomesTechnical SkillsExperience with Copilot Studio, Azure AI Studio, and generative AI models (e.g., GPT-4)Strong understanding of AI agent orchestration patterns, RAG (retrieval augmented generation), GenAI models (SLM/LLM), and prompt engineeringProficiency in Microsoft Power Platform (Power Apps, Power Automate, and Power Virtual Agents)Development and solutioning experience in SharePoint Online with focus on integration with agentic AI solutions and Power PlatformEnterprise experience with cloud security roles and custom entity creationStrong understanding of Dataverse, APIs, connectors, and integration strategiesExperience with agile methodologies and DevOps practicesProgramming familiarity with Python and JSONFamiliarity with cloud platforms (e.g., Azure, AWS) and containerization technologies (e.g., Docker, Kubernetes)Familiarity with ServiceNOW integration and Moveworks Agent Studio (nice to have)Familiarity with Azure AI Services and Azure AI Foundry (nice to have)Certifications such as Microsoft Azure AI Engineer Associate, PL-200, or PL-400 are a plusThis position requires written and oral fluency in English. The successful candidate will be required to support or collaborate with English-speaking colleagues or stakeholders nationally in our English speaking provinces while at KPMG.KPMG BC Region Pay Range InformationThe expected base salary range for this position is $74,400 to $111,600 and may be eligible for bonus awards. The determination of an applicant’s base salary within this range is based on the individual’s location, skills & competencies, and unique qualifications.
